Output e21051a9290c1d64d553f0628530a1e87fc5807c26e036cd8fb50745c440d3af:0

value
8901557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af61437022faeaec0afd4c697858245a1480c48 OP_EQUAL
address
3CuB9p83QwBDuaD28jzkyEbyrFGLmvKM2N
transaction
e21051a9290c1d64d553f0628530a1e87fc5807c26e036cd8fb50745c440d3af
spent
true